Issue #11675 has been updated by Daniel Pittman.

Bill Tong wrote:
> I don't know if this is helpful or not, but I see this:
>     Jan nn nn:nn:nn puppet-agent[PID]: 
> (/Stage[main]/Rootuser/User[root]/expiry) defined 'expiry' as '2099-12-31'

Is this the output you see along with the resource specification you gave?  I 
ask, because the value being set and the value in your resource are different.  
That would result in trying to apply this change every time Puppet ran; can you 
also give us the output of `getent ... root` for the various sources (passwd, 
shadow).  Feel free to strip the content of the password hash field, which we 
don't need. :)
----------------------------------------
Bug #11675: user expiry option fills up the logs
https://projects.puppetlabs.com/issues/11675

Author: Bill Tong
Status: Needs More Information
Priority: Normal
Assignee: Bill Tong
Category: 
Target version: 
Affected Puppet version: 2.7.9
Keywords: 
Branch: 


puppet should not change the expiry for a user unless the requested expiry 
differs from the current expiry.

user { "root": uid => 0, ensure => "present", "expiry" => "2015-01-01", }

will *always* log every time puppet runs.



-- 
You have received this notification because you have either subscribed to it, 
or are involved in it.
To change your notification preferences, please click here: 
http://projects.puppetlabs.com/my/account

-- 
You received this message because you are subscribed to the Google Groups 
"Puppet Bugs" group.
To post to this group, send email to [email protected].
To unsubscribe from this group, send email to 
[email protected].
For more options, visit this group at 
http://groups.google.com/group/puppet-bugs?hl=en.

Reply via email to